Output 98268ad438e31cdab253559f7774861aeaf9f792ec7834124c6da032927a0a55:1

value
3496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e7d19e8f68d53cf7d7a33aa58650c13b1405d4a OP_EQUAL
address
3EgRjy7GUqD2wZ8qDxqNUAhWrp3vcUvcQd
transaction
98268ad438e31cdab253559f7774861aeaf9f792ec7834124c6da032927a0a55